Prep Time: 10 mins
Cook Time: 30 mins
Total Time: 40 mins
Cuisine: American
Serves: 4 servings

Ingredients

  1. 4 chicken breasts
  2. 1 can creamed corn
  3. 1 cup milk
  4. 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  5.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Begin by gathering all your ingredients: 4 chicken breasts, 1 can of creamed corn, 1 cup of milk, 1 teaspoon of garlic powder, salt, and pepper.
  2.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) to ensure it's ready for the chicken.
  3. In a large skillet, heat a tablespoon of oil over medium-high heat. Season the chicken breasts with salt, pepper, and garlic powder on both sides.
  4. Once the skillet is hot, add the seasoned chicken breasts. Sear them for about 5-7 minutes on each side until they are golden brown. This step helps to lock in the juices and flavor.
  5. While the chicken is cooking, in a separate bowl, combine the creamed corn and milk. Stir well until the mixture is smooth and evenly mixed.
  6. After the chicken has browned, remove it from the skillet and place it in a baking dish. Pour the creamed corn mixture over the chicken, ensuring each piece is well coated.
  7. Cover the baking dish with aluminum foil to retain moisture during cooking.
  8. Transfer the baking dish to the preheated oven and bake for 20-25 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through and reaches an internal temperature of 165°F (75°C).
  9. Once done, carefully remove the baking dish from the oven and let it rest for 5 minutes before serving. This allows the juices to redistribute throughout the chicken.
  10. Serve the chicken hot, spooning the creamy corn mixture over the top. Pair it with your favorite side dishes, such as rice, mashed potatoes, or steamed vegetables.

Tips

  1. Temperature is Key: Always ensure your chicken reaches an internal temperature of 165°F (75°C) to guarantee it's fully cooked and safe to eat.
  2. Searing Secrets: When browning the chicken, make sure your skillet is hot before adding the meat. This creates a beautiful golden crust that locks in flavor and moisture.
  3. Milk Matters: Use whole milk for a richer, creamier sauce. If you're watching calories, you can substitute with 2% milk, but avoid skim milk as it won't provide the same luxurious texture.
  4. Seasoning Hack: Don't be afraid to experiment with your seasonings. Try adding a pinch of paprika or dried thyme to the garlic powder for an extra flavor boost.
  5. Resting is Crucial: Always let your chicken rest for 5 minutes after cooking. This allows the juices to redistribute, ensuring each bite is moist and tender.
  6. Make it Your Own: Feel free to customize this dish by adding some shredded cheese on top during the last few minutes of baking or sprinkling some fresh herbs like parsley before serving.
